All Seasons Nails & Spa Hours of Operation and Locations in New York
- 2 Locations in New York
- www.allseasonnailsnh.com
- All Seasons Nails & Spa Hours
- Category: Beauty & Health
-
41 West End AveView Store Details
(212) 582-8822 -
2566 BroadwayView Store Details
(212) 666-8822